Author Larry McMurtry dies at 84

"'It ain't dying I'm talking about, it's living. I doubt it matters where you die, but it matters where you live.'" -Augustus McCrae, Lonesome Dove Larry McMurtry, often referred to as the novelist of the American West, died Thursday, March 25 at home in Archer City, Texas, at the age of 84 years. Most notable of his works: Lonesome Dove. See what other works of his we have at the OPL that you might enjoy.
